List of all items
Structs
- ByteView
- CacheConfig
- Config
- ConstIter
- ConstMap
- ConstMapShard
- ConstShard
- ConstTree
- NoHook
- ShutdownSignal
- TreeMeta
- TypedIter
- TypedMap
- TypedMapShard
- TypedRef
- TypedShard
- TypedTree
- VarIter
- VarMap
- VarMapShard
- VarShard
- VarTree
- VarTypedIter
- VarTypedMap
- VarTypedMapShard
- VarTypedShard
- VarTypedTree
- ZeroIter
- ZeroMap
- ZeroMapShard
- ZeroShard
- ZeroTree
- armour::db::CollectionInfo
- armour::db::Db
- armour::db::DbInfo
- armour::handler::TypedMapHandler
- armour::handler::TypedTreeHandler
- armour::handler::VarTypedMapHandler
- armour::handler::VarTypedTreeHandler
- armour::handler::ZeroMapHandler
- armour::handler::ZeroTreeHandler
- armour::rpc::RpcHandle
- armour::seq::SeqGen
- armour::typed_client::TypedRpcClient
- codec::BytemuckCodec
- codec::BytemuckSliceCodec
- codec::RapiraCodec
- codec::ZerocopyCodec
- compaction::Compactor
- compaction::NoReplicationGuard
- durability::Bitcask
- durability::Fixed
- fixed::bitmap::Bitmap
- fixed::config::FixedConfig
- fixed::shard::FixedShardInner
- fixed_replication::client::FixedReplicationClient
- fixed_replication::cursor::FixedReplicationCursor
- fixed_replication::protocol::Ack
- fixed_replication::protocol::CaughtUp
- fixed_replication::protocol::Frame
- fixed_replication::protocol::ShardInfo
- fixed_replication::protocol::SlotBatchDecoder
- fixed_replication::protocol::SlotBatchEncoder
- fixed_replication::protocol::SlotEventIter
- fixed_replication::protocol::SlotEventRef
- fixed_replication::protocol::SyncRequest
- fixed_replication::server::FixedReplicationServer
- replication::RawEntry
- replication::ReplicationCursor
- replication::ReplicationEntry
- replication::ReplicationRegistry
- replication::ShardLogReader
- replication::client::ReplicationClient
- replication::client::ReplicationClientOptions
- replication::protocol::AckMessage
- replication::protocol::CaughtUp
- replication::protocol::EntryBatch
- replication::protocol::Frame
- replication::protocol::ShardInfo
- replication::protocol::SyncRequest
- replication::protocol::WireEntry
- replication::server::ReplicationServer
- replication::server::ReplicationServerOptions
Enums
- DbError
- MigrateAction
- SchemaMismatchKind
- fixed_replication::apply::ApplyOutcome
- fixed_replication::event::FixedReplicationEvent
- fixed_replication::protocol::FixedMessageType
- replication::ApplyOutcome
- replication::protocol::MessageType
Traits
- CollectionMeta
- Key
- Location
- TypedWriteHook
- WriteHook
- armour::collection::Collection
- armour::handler::RpcHandler
- codec::BytemuckVec
- codec::Codec
- compaction::CompactionGuard
- compaction::CompactionIndex
- durability::Durability
- durability::DurabilityInner
- fixed_replication::apply::FixedReplicationTarget
- fixed_replication::engine_access::FixedEngineAccess
- replication::ReplicationTarget
Macros
- const_map
- const_tree
- impl_key_bytemuck
- impl_key_zerocopy
- typed_map
- typed_tree
- var_map
- var_tree
- var_typed_map
- var_typed_tree
- zero_map
- zero_tree
Functions
- compaction::compact_shard
- compaction::compact_shard_guarded
- fixed::slot::bump_version
- fixed::slot::compute_crc
- fixed::slot::is_newer
- fixed::slot::meta_of
- fixed::slot::pack_meta
- fixed::slot::read_slot
- fixed::slot::serialize_slot
- fixed::slot::slot_size
- fixed::slot::status_of
- fixed::slot::version_of
- fixed::slot::with_status
- fixed_replication::protocol::decode_error
- fixed_replication::protocol::encode_error
- fixed_replication::protocol::encode_heartbeat
- fixed_replication::protocol::read_frame
- fixed_replication::protocol::write_frame
- replication::protocol::decode_error
- replication::protocol::encode_error
- replication::protocol::encode_heartbeat
- replication::protocol::read_frame
- replication::protocol::write_frame
Type Aliases
- DbResult
- armour::handler::KeyBytes
- armour::handler::ValueBytes
- armour::migration::TypedMigration
- armour::migration::TypedMigrationFn
- armour::rpc::TreeMap
- fixed::FixedMap
- fixed::FixedTree
- fixed_replication::engine_access::ArcEngine
Constants
- fixed::slot::SLOT_DELETED
- fixed::slot::SLOT_FREE
- fixed::slot::SLOT_HEADER_SIZE
- fixed::slot::SLOT_OCCUPIED
- fixed::slot::STATUS_DELETED
- fixed::slot::STATUS_FREE
- fixed::slot::STATUS_OCCUPIED
- fixed::slot::VERSION_WARN_THRESHOLD
- fixed_replication::client::RECONNECT_BASE_MS
- fixed_replication::client::RECONNECT_MAX_MS
- fixed_replication::cursor::CURSOR_FILE
- fixed_replication::cursor::CURSOR_SAVE_INTERVAL
- fixed_replication::cursor::CURSOR_SIZE
- fixed_replication::protocol::ACK_INTERVAL
- fixed_replication::protocol::BATCH_MAX_BYTES
- fixed_replication::protocol::BATCH_MAX_ENTRIES
- fixed_replication::protocol::FLAG_EMPTY_STATE
- fixed_replication::protocol::HEARTBEAT_INTERVAL_SECS
- fixed_replication::protocol::MAX_FRAME_PAYLOAD
- fixed_replication::protocol::PROTOCOL_VERSION
- fixed_replication::protocol::TAIL_POLL_MS
- fixed_replication::server::SPSC_CAPACITY
- replication::protocol::MAX_FRAME_SIZE
- replication::server::HEARTBEAT_INTERVAL_SECS